Why Only 30 Days?

I wanted to keep it a simple 30 days so there wouldn’t be any added pressure to create something like a full blown software program or 12 part series (which you absolutely can, if you like! ;) ).  But I just wanted people to create something that wouldn’t take an exorbitant amount of time to produce.  I chose an ebook because I think it’s do-able. It won’t be a 50 or 60 pager, but I hope it’s enough to satisfy folks who can really use it.  30 days is just enough time to think of an idea, plan and draft it and create it.
